PEPPERED PORK TENDERLOIN

Peppered pork is really delicious -- the pepper is not overpowering, it adds a bit of a bite and a lot of flavor.

Time 1h20m

Number Of Ingredients 6

2 lb pork tenderloins (1 pound each)
1 Tbsp freshly ground black pepper (coarsely ground) (more if needed)
1/2 c white wine
1/2 c chicken broth
1/2 c low-fat sour cream
2 tsp dijon mustard (coarse ground, country style (or more to suit your taste)

Steps:

  • 1. Roll tenderloins in pepper to coat. Place in a roasting pan and bake in a pre-heated 350 degrees F for 30-40 minutes.
  • 2. Remove from oven. Place pork on a cuttting board and drain fat from pan.
  • 3. Pour wine into pan and place over high heat, scraping up any browned bits with a wooden spoon. Add broth and cook until reduced by half.
  • 4. Remove from heat and stir in sour cream and mustard. Slice pork and top with sauce.
